In an interesting ligtening talk at W3C TP this afternoon Håkon Wium Lie described "How web fonts can change the face of the web." He showed that there are very few fonts one can reliably assume are on a client machine. He then showed how CSS 2.0 can reference on-line server-side fonts that can be dynamically downloaded when a web page is viewed.

In the TSSG we have been tracking a number of technologies that converge around the idea of the web browser as a flexible docking station for various applications. I am borrowing for a lot that my colleague Eamonn de Leastar has investigated for this posting. The source of these innovations stems from the desire to create a "My X", such as "My Netscape" or the Google customised home page.
You could say this trend for personalised portals started with the Netscape portal idea of the late 1990s that led to the original RSS 0.90 (Rich Site Summary) in 1999. See this History of RSS if you're interested in that journey. There are things before RSS 0.90, but they weren't called RSS (most importantly Dave Winner's Scripting News format). Since then the alternative Atom format has been developed and standardised in the IETF. This history is also linked to the early W3C semantic web standard RDF (Resource Description Framework), and some RSS versions are subsets of RDF.
So the basic idea was that these feed formats could be used to allow syndication and aggregation of content across many different types of content sources such as newspapers and later blogs, but including weather and other sorts of information flows.
The bigger picture with portals is to allow functionality to be bundled into widgets (small sets of functionality) that can allow a host platform to grow through the use of 3rd party information sources (mini-programs). So the feed is the basic low-level entry point here, a simple flow of textual data marked up with XML in RSS or Atom into headline, content and link to original source. The more complex widgets can then become the requirement becomes for a program rather than just an XML parser to allow the widget to function.
The other concept that has become very important recently has been client-side scripting sometimes called AJAX (Asynchronous JavaScript and XML), though it doesn't necessarily require JavaScript or even XML to be branded AJAX. Basically it's about using clever client-side web programming techniques to improve the end-user experience, often by pre-fetching server-side data before the user explicitly requests it. Very clever AJAX solutions are emerging that can handle disconnection from the network for periods of time.
One alternative framework to JavaScript is that of Adobe Flash, most commonly associated with multimedia content, but now being used as a light deployment platform (to those with browsers with a Flash plug-in). The latest innovation here is Adobe's Apollo.

Netcraft's survey of SSL sites has now been running for over ten years. The first survey, in November 1996, found just 3,283 sites; since then, the number of SSL sites has had an average compound growth of 65% per annum.
The survey is a good guide to the growth of online trading and services. The survey counts sites by collecting SSL certificates; each distinct, valid SSL certificate is counted in the results. Each SSL certificate typically represents one company's details, and each certificate must be approved by a certificate authority, so the data is typically more consistent and less volatile than other attributes of the Internet's infrastructure.
Netcraft: Internet Passes 600,000 SSL Sites.
This is many fewer than the total number of websites, current Netcraft web server survey, as I access it now in May 2007 it reads 118,023,363 sites.

Paul Kiel posts on O'Reilly's XML.com Profiling XML Schema analysing what features of XML schemas are actually used in practice, and advising on the schema features to avoid. Very interesting.... Not surprisingly the vast majority of schemas analysed stuck to simplicity, to quote from Paul's conclusions "The clearest message is one of simplicity. The most commonly used constructs involve merely creating reusable types, assembling them into sequences of elements, and augmenting them with enumerations. Many of the more complex features went unused."

Gartner's 2006 Emerging Technologies Hype Cycle Highlights Key Technology Themes
1. Web 2.0Web 2.0 represents a broad collection of recent trends in Internet technologies and business models. Particular focus has been given to user-created content, lightweight technology, service-based access and shared revenue models. Technologies rated by Gartner as having transformational, high or moderate impact include:
Social Network Analysis (SNA) is rated as high impact (definition: enables new ways of performing vertical applications that will result in significantly increased revenue or cost savings for an enterprise) and capable of reaching maturity in less than two years. SNA is the use of information and knowledge from many people and their personal networks. It involves collecting massive amounts of data from multiple sources, analyzing the data to identify relationships and mining it for new information. Gartner said that SNA can successfully impact a business by being used to identify target markets, create successful project teams and serendipitously identify unvoiced conclusions.
Ajax is also rated as high impact and capable of reaching maturity in less than two years. Ajax is a collection of techniques that Web developers use to deliver an enhanced, more-responsive user experience in the confines of a modern browser (for example, recent version of Internet Explorer, Firefox, Mozilla, Safari or Opera). A narrow-scope use of Ajax can have a limited impact in terms of making a difficult-to-use Web application somewhat less difficult. However, Gartner said, even this limited impact is worth it, and users will appreciate incremental improvements in the usability of applications. High levels of impact and business value can only be achieved when the development process encompasses innovations in usability and reliance on complementary server-side processing (as is done in Google Maps).
Collective intelligence, rated as transformational (definition: enables new ways of doing business across industries that will result in major shifts in industry dynamics) is expected to reach mainstream adoption in five to ten years. Collective intelligence is an approach to producing intellectual content (such as code, documents, indexing and decisions) that results from individuals working together with no centralized authority. This is seen as a more cost-efficient way of producing content, metadata, software and certain services.
Mashup is rated as moderate on the Hype Cycle (definition: provides incremental improvements to established processes that will result in increased revenue or cost savings for an enterprise), but is expected to hit mainstream adoption in less than two years. A "mashup" is a lightweight tactical integration of multi-sourced applications or content into a single offering. Because mashups leverage data and services from public Web sites and Web applications, they池e lightweight in implementation and built with a minimal amount of code. Their primary business benefit is that they can quickly meet tactical needs with reduced development costs and improved user satisfaction. Gartner warns that because they combine data and logic from multiple sources, they池e vulnerable to failures in any one of those sources.
2. Real World Web
Increasingly, real-world objects will not only contain local processing capabilities妖ue to the falling size and cost of microprocessors傭ut they will also be able to interact with their surroundings through sensing and networking capabilities. The emergence of this Real World Web will bring the power of the Web, which today is perceived as a "separate" virtual place, to the user's point of need of information or transaction. Technologies rated as having particularly high impact include:
Location-aware technologies should hit maturity in less than two years. Location-aware technology is the use of GPS (global positioning system), assisted GPS (A-GPS), Enhanced Observed Time Difference (EOTD), enhanced GPS (E-GPS), and other technologies in the cellular network and handset to locate a mobile user. Users should evaluate the potential benefits to their business processes of location-enabled products such as personal navigation devices (for example, TomTom or Garmin) or Bluetooth-enabled GPS receivers, as well as WLAN location equipment that may help automate complex processes, such as logistics and maintenance. Whereas the market sees consolidation around a reduced number of high-accuracy technologies, the location service ecosystem will benefit from a number of standardized application interfaces to deploy location services and applications for a wide range of wireless devices.
Location-aware applications will hit mainsteam adoption in the next two to five years. An increasing number of organizations have deployed location-aware mobile business applications, mostly based on GPS-enabled devices, to support queue business processes and activities, such as field force management, fleet management, logistics and good transportation. The market is in an early adoption phase, and Europe is slightly ahead of the United States, due to the higher maturity of mobile networks, their availability and standardization.
Sensor Mesh Networks are ad hoc networks formed by dynamic meshes of peer nodes, each of which includes simple networking, computing and sensing capabilities. Some implementations offer low-power operation and multi-year battery life. Technologically aggressive organizations looking for low-cost sensing and robust self-organizing networks with small data transmission volumes should explore sensor networking. The market is still immature and fragmented, and there are few standards, so suppliers will evolve and equipment could become obsolete relatively rapidly. Therefore, this area should be seen as a tactical investment, as mainstream adoption is not expected for more than ten years.
3. Applications Architecture
The software infrastructure that provides the foundation for modern business applications continues to mirror business requirements more directly. The modularity and agility offered by service oriented architecture at the technology level and business process management at the business level will continue to evolve through high impact shifts such as model-driven and event-driven architectures, and corporate semantic Web. Technologies rated as having particularly high impact include:
Event-driven Architecture (EDA) is an architectural style for distributed applications, in which certain discrete functions are packaged into modular, encapsulated, shareable components, some of which are triggered by the arrival of one or more event objects. Event objects may be generated directly by an application, or they may be generated by an adapter or agent that operates non-invasively (for example, by examining message headers and message contents).EDA has an impact on every industry. Although mainstream adoption of all forms of EDA is still five to ten years away, complex-event processing EDA is now being used in financial trading, energy trading, supply chain, fraud detection, homeland security, telecommunications, customer contact center management, logistics and sensor networks, such as those based on RFID.
Model-driven Architecture is a registered trademark of the Object Management Group (OMG). It describes OMG's proposed approach to separating business-level functionality from the technical nuances of its implementation The premise behind OMG's Model-Driven Architecture and the broader family of model-driven approaches (MDAs) is to enable business-level functionality to be modeled by standards, such as Unified Modeling Language (UML) in OMG's case; allow the models to exist independently of platform-induced constraints and requirements; and then instantiate those models into specific runtime implementations, based on the target platform of choice. MDAs reinforce the focus on business first and technology second. The concepts focus attention on modeling the business: business rules, business roles, business interactions and so on. The instantiation of these business models in specific software applications or components flows from the business model. By reinforcing the business-level focus and coupling MDAs with SOA concepts, you end up with a system that is inherently more flexible and adaptable.
Corporate Semantic Web applies semantic Web technologies, aka semantic markup languages (for example, Resource Description Framework, Web Ontology Language and topic maps), to corporate Web content. Although mainstream adoption is still five to ten years away, many corporate IT areas are starting to engage in semantic Web technologies. Early adopters are in the areas of enterprise information integration, content management, life sciences and government. Corporate Semantic Web will reduce costs and improve the quality of content management, information access, system interoperability, database integration and data quality.

Each Hype Cycle Model follows five stages:
1. "Technology Trigger"
The first phase of a Hype Cycle is the "technology trigger" or breakthrough, product launch or other event that generates significant press and interest.2. "Peak of Inflated Expectations"
In the next phase, a frenzy of publicity typically generates over-enthusiasm and unrealistic expectations. There may be some successful applications of a technology, but there are typically more failures.3. "Trough of Disillusionment"
Technologies enter the "trough of disillusionment" because they fail to meet expectations and quickly become unfashionable. Consequently, the press usually abandons the topic and the technology.4. "Slope of Enlightenment"
Although the press may have stopped covering the technology, some businesses continue through the "slope of enlightenment" and experiment to understand the benefits and practical application of the technology.5. "Plateau of Productivity"
A technology reaches the "plateau of productivity" as the benefits of it become widely demonstrated and accepted. The technology becomes increasingly stable and evolves in second and third generations. The final height of the plateau varies according to whether the technology is broadly applicable or benefits only a niche market

I am in Brussels at the NESSI General Assembly. This is a new type of process being promoted by the European Commission in advance of the new 7th Framework Programe, the next phase of the EC research funding process (due to formally cover 2007-2013). The idea is to allow key commercial interests to form a "Technology Platform" providing a forum for companies to meet and define a common research agenda that defines roadmap(s) addressing the strategic development of the industrial sector in Europe (primarily the EU 25 member states).
NESSI, Networked European Software Services Initiative, is one of these technology platforms (or ETPs), currently comprising 22 core partners from four types of organisation: industry, SMEs (Small and Medium-sized Enterprises) academia, user group representation.
As of now the overall strategic objectives have been documented SRA (Strategic Research Agenda) Volume 1: Framing the future of the service oriented economy and further documents are in progress.
It is certain that the general move of Information Communication Technologies (ICT) towards services is a global technology trend. The ambitious aim of this initiative is to help define this trend in an integrative way that encompases end users, technologists (academic and indistrial) and solutions providers.

From the monthly Netcraft web server survey Netcraft: Apache Now the Leader in SSL Servers
As the original developers of the SSL protocol, Netscape started out with a lead in the SSL server market. But they were soon overtaken by Microsoft's Internet Information Server, which within a few years held a steady 40-50% of the SSL server market.
Apache has taken much longer to reach the top. Version 1 of Apache did not include SSL support : in the 1990s, US export controls, and the patent on the RSA algorithm in the US, meant that cryptographic support for open source projects had to be developed outside of the US, and were distributed separately. Several independent projects provided SSL support for Apache, including Apache-SSL and mod_ssl; but commercial spin-offs, like Stronghold by c2net (later bought by Red Hat), were more popular at that time.
Now that mod_ssl is included as standard in version 2, Apache has become more popular for hosting secure websites. The total for Apache includes other projects from the ASF including Tomcat, and includes Apache-SSL, but does not include derived products like Stronghold or IBM HTTP Server. c2net/Red Hat includes only Stronghold and Red Hat SWS.
Apache is also gaining from geographical changes. The US, where Microsoft retains a strong lead, used to have over 70% of the Internet's secure websites. Other countries have been catching up, however: countries including Japan and Germany, where Apache is preferred, have faster growth in SSL sites. As ecommerce has caught on in other countries, the US share has been diluted, and is now only 50%.

This article includes a good summary of the current state of HTTP authentication XML.com: httplib2: HTTP Persistence and Authentication, in the context of developing a Python HTTP client library (httplib2) to support what should be supported. Here's the main of argument extracted:
In the past, people have asked me how to protect their web services and I've told them to just use HTTP authentication, by which I meant either Basic or Digest as defined in RFC 2617.
For most authentication requirements, using Basic alone isn't really an option since it transmits your name and password unencrypted. Yes, it encodes them as base64, but that's not encryption.
The other option is Digest, which tries to protect your password by not transferring it directly, but uses challenges and hashes to let the client prove to the server that it knows a shared secret.
Here's the "executive summary" of HTTP Digest authentication:The problem with Digest is that it suffers from too many options, which are implemented non-uniformly, and not always correctly. For example, there is an option to include the entity body in the calculation of the hash, called auth-int. There are also two different kinds of hashing, MD5 and MD5-sess. The server can return a fresh challenge nonce with every response, or the client can include a monotonically increasing nonce-count value with each request. The server also has the option of returning a digest of its own, which is a way the server can prove to the client that it also knows the shared secret.
- The server rejects an unauthenticated request with a challenge. That challenge contains a nonce, a random string generated by the server.
- The client responds with the same request again, but this time with a WWW-Authenticate: header that contains a hash of the supplied nonce, the username, the password, the request URI, and the HTTP method.
...
The bad news is that current state of security with HTTP is bad. The best interoperable solution is Basic over HTTPS. The good news is that everyone agrees the situation stinks and there are multiple efforts afoot to fix the problem. Just be warned that security is not a one-size-fits-all game and that the result of all this heat and smoke may be several new authentication schemes, each targeted at a different user community.
